Arrest After Motor Thefts

OFFICERS investigating a number of reports of thefts from motor vehicles have arrested a man.

Between Wednesday, 26 January and Wednesday, 2 February, a number of vehicles were broken into in areas between Burghclere and Beacon Hills.

Items including number plates, Apple Airpods, handbags and clothing were stolen.

On Saturday, 5 February, officers arrested a 47-year-old man from Havant on suspicion of the following offences: Theft from a motor vehicle in Whitchurch between Wednesday 26, January and Wednesday 2 February; Theft from a motor vehicle in Micheldever on Wednesday, 26 January; Theft from a motor vehicle in East Stratton on Thursday, 27 January; Theft from a motor vehicle in Dummer on Friday, 28 January; Theft from a motor vehicle at Beacon Hill on Saturday, 29 January; Theft from a motor vehicle at Beacon Hill on Saturday, 29 January; Theft from a motor vehicle at Beacon Hill on Saturday, 29 January. He has been questioned by officers and released under investigation while enquiries continue.

A police spokesperson said: “Information that we receive from the community is vital and informs where we put our resources and take action against any illegal activity.

We would like to take this opportunity to remind motorists to make sure you remove valuables from your vehicle and lock it.

Make sure to physically check that doors and windows are locked, especially if you have used the remote to lock the vehicle, then look inside again to make sure you’ve not left anything.”
